Output 102e21a3f067307650a59552bae1c7e86ca9d41beeac21d9df442d71b1f4b49c:5

value
1175648
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 edeabc5b29dc182009f2f4dd396d5dd0de39d3538d924652609aff7054e4aa00
address
bc1pah4tckefmsvzqz0j7nwnjm2a6r0rn56n3kfyv5nqntlhq48y4gqq29rlde
transaction
102e21a3f067307650a59552bae1c7e86ca9d41beeac21d9df442d71b1f4b49c
spent
true